Transaction 7c3904de31fca2708b1f4ea1b39a303d2bfc929a4e76c51e39dc036da85f8864

11 Input
2 Outputs
  • 7c3904de31fca2708b1f4ea1b39a303d2bfc929a4e76c51e39dc036da85f8864:0
  • value  21399
    address  bc1q3a2f7xyl262qscpexvp5fjfxkj6gyq0jjmuhah
  • 7c3904de31fca2708b1f4ea1b39a303d2bfc929a4e76c51e39dc036da85f8864:1
  • value  7300000
    address  bc1qxpc7455xt7mshhdml2063ysctdcs9jtkausevp